Hello,
Thanks so much for mentioning my book, Kim.

I really appreciate it, and the kind words mean a lot to me.
Forums are definitely a commitment of time. You can't launch a forum and then leave it, it's a regular thing you have to invest into. They aren't for everyone (depends on various factors), but they can be beneficial to businesses and others looking to generate traffic, create greater loyalty, etc. It really depends on what you want to do and what time you have available to commit. But, suffice to say, yes, it is hard work.
I would caution against using other forums to promote your own, as a general practice. Sure, signature links (if the site allows them) are OK, but mentioning your site in posts, PMs, etc. is generally a no no as it'll tarnish your reputation. As a community administrator, I try to treat people as I'd like to be treated - you probably don't want others coming to your forums and using it in that fashion, so that's a good way to look at how you yourself should act. (Of course, on the flip side, if you let people do it on your site, don't assume it's OK elsewhere).
I hope that this helps.
Thanks,
Patrick